Lloyd Scott Obituary

Lloyd Roger Scott

April 26, 1942 - December 16, 2024

Lloyd Roger Scott, age 82, departed this earth on December 16, 2024 to join his beloved wife and the Lord and Angels in Heaven. He was the son of the late Hazel Morris Scott and Eugene "Tennie" Scott. He was the proud husband of Donna Church Scott for 54 years, and a loving father and grandfather. Roger grew up in Nickelsville, VA and later attended Virginia Tech, where he met his wife Donna. Roger served the town of Nickelsville as a postmaster for several years. Roger served his country in the Virginia Army National Guard and the United States Army. Roger had many leadership roles in the National Guard, attaining the rank of Brigadier General. He loved doing things for his family and was always there when you needed him. Roger owned several Harley-Davidson motorcycles throughout the years and enjoyed multiple cross-country trips with Donna. In addition to his parents and wife, Roger was preceded in death by his sister Myralyn Shayne Scott and brother Ivan G. Scott. He is survived by his son, Brian and wife Brenda of Montpelier, his daughter Diane and husband Chris Murphy of Glen Allen, and grandchildren Lexi and Charlie Scott and Annabelle Murphy. Also surviving are his sister Irana Scott of Harrisonburg and several nieces, nephews and cousins. The family will receive friends at Bliley's Funeral Home, 8510 Staples Mill Road on Friday, December 27, from 4 to 6 p.m. with services starting at 6 p.m. Memorial contributions may be made to Nickelsville United Methodist Church, PO Box 70, Nickelsville, VA 24271, or a charity of your choice. A joint burial for both Roger and Donna will be conducted at the Amelia Veteran's Cemetery in Amelia, VA at a later date.
